The Town (Al-Balad)
20 verses, revealed in Mecca after Q (Qaaf) before The Comet (Al-Taareq)
In the name of Allah, the Entirely Merciful, the Especially Merciful
۞ No, I swear by this country (Mecca), 1 And thou shalt be allowed in yonder city 2 And the begetter and that which he begat, 3 Certainly We have created man to be in distress. 4 Does he think then that no one has power over him? 5 (He boasts and shows off) saying, "I have spent a great deal of money (for the cause of God)". 6 Does he then think that no one sees him? 7 Have We not given him two eyes, 8 and a tongue and two lips? 9 and guided him on the two paths (of good and evil)? 10 So he did not quickly enter the steep valley. 11 What could let you know what the height is! 12 (It is:) freeing the bondman; 13 or the feeding in times of famine 14 An orphan of near relationship 15 or some needy person in distress, 16 Then will he be of those who believe, and enjoin patience, (constancy, and self-restraint), and enjoin deeds of kindness and compassion. 17 These are the People of the Right Hand. 18 And those who disbelieve Our signs - they are the fellows of the lefthand. 19 Over them will be fire closed in. 20
Almighty Allah's Truth.
End of Surah: The Town (Al-Balad). Sent down in Mecca after Q (Qaaf) before The Comet (Al-Taareq)
